What are the best ways to track airdrops in the cryptocurrency industry?
Can you provide some effective methods for tracking airdrops in the cryptocurrency industry? I'm looking for ways to stay updated on upcoming airdrops and ensure that I don't miss out on any opportunities. Any suggestions?

- Clayton McleodOct 22, 2024 · 2 years agoOne of the best ways to track airdrops in the cryptocurrency industry is to follow reliable cryptocurrency news websites and blogs. They often provide updates on upcoming airdrops and provide detailed information on how to participate. Additionally, joining cryptocurrency communities and forums can also be helpful as members often share information about airdrops they come across. Make sure to do your own research and verify the legitimacy of the airdrops before participating. Another effective method is to follow official social media accounts of cryptocurrency projects and exchanges. They often announce airdrops and provide instructions on how to participate. Twitter, Telegram, and Reddit are popular platforms where such announcements are made. Set up notifications for these accounts to stay updated on the latest airdrop opportunities. Using airdrop tracking platforms and websites can also simplify the process. These platforms aggregate information about upcoming airdrops and provide details such as eligibility criteria, distribution dates, and token allocation. Some popular airdrop tracking platforms include AirdropAlert, AirdropBob, and CoinMarketCap's Airdrop Tracker. These platforms can save you time and effort by providing all the necessary information in one place. Remember to always exercise caution and be wary of potential scams. Never share your private keys or personal information with unknown sources. It's important to stay vigilant and verify the legitimacy of the airdrops before participating.
